Challenge …We accept the challenge to help you meet your media needs
Solution …Creative, Cost-Effective Presentations!
Results …Award Winning Productions!
Communicate – Educate – Inspire – Inform – Train – Sell – Motivate
DoD video, to show new recruits the induction process